Each connection table entry resides in 32 bytes. The pointers to these connection tables reside in the
parameter RAM.
31.9.1
Receive Connection Table (RCT)
shows the format of an RCT entry.
NOTE
For an active channel, the CP uses a burst cycle to fetch the 32-byte RCT
and writes back only the first 24 bytes.
